Install a car neck or lumbar pillow only while the vehicle is parked and switched off. Place the pillow at the intended part of the seat, route the elastic strap around a compatible section, and adjust it in small steps. Before driving, confirm that the pillow and strap remain clear of the head restraint, seat belt, airbags, controls and your normal driving movement.
Before installation: inspect the seat
Do not begin by stretching the strap around the first available part of the seat. Take a minute to identify:
- Seat-mounted airbag seams or labels.
- Seat-belt anchors and belt guides.
- Head-restraint posts, releases and adjustment controls.
- Power-seat switches, levers and folding mechanisms.
- Any opening where a strap could slip, rub or become pinched.
If you cannot route the strap without crossing one of these areas, do not install the pillow on that seat.
Step 1: Confirm which pillow you have
The smaller rounded style is the Neck Pillow. The wider, three-panel style is the Lumbar Pillow.
This distinction matters because the neck pillow belongs near a compatible headrest or upper seatback, while the lumbar pillow belongs against the lower seatback. Reversing the positions can make the cushion feel awkward and may change your seating position more than intended.
Step 2: Start with the strap loose
Place the pillow against the seat before tightening or stretching the rear elastic strap. Check that the front surface faces the occupant and that the pillow is not twisted.
Route the strap around a compatible part of the seat. It should hold the pillow in place without pulling on trim, airbag seams, seat-belt hardware or controls.
Step 3: Position a neck pillow
Sit in your normal position and place the rounded pillow near the gap below the head restraint or along the upper seatback. The Car Gadget Store neck style offers two rear strap-height positions.
Test the lower setting first, then the higher setting if necessary. The pillow should not push the head forward, prevent the head restraint from adjusting or change your view of the road.
Make every adjustment while parked.
Step 4: Position a lumbar pillow
Place the rectangular three-panel pillow against the lower seatback. Begin low and make small upward adjustments until it fills the intended gap.
Avoid placing it so high that it acts like an upper-back cushion. After each change, check that your hips remain fully back in the seat and that your normal reach to the steering wheel and pedals has not changed.
Step 5: Run a complete control check
Before driving, confirm all of the following:
- The factory head restraint still operates and can be positioned correctly.
- The seat belt lies normally across the body and retracts without obstruction.
- The pillow and strap are clear of every visible airbag seam.
- Seat controls, release levers and folding mechanisms remain accessible.
- You can see clearly and reach the wheel and pedals normally.
- The pillow stays in place when you enter, exit and settle into the seat.
If any check fails, reposition or remove the pillow.
Common installation mistakes
Choosing appearance before placement
A pillow may look symmetrical at the center of the seat but still sit too high or too low for the occupant. Use your normal seating position as the reference.
Pulling the strap too tight
Excess tension can distort the pillow, pull on seat trim or make the strap migrate. It needs to be secure, not overstretched.
Covering a side-airbag seam
Never assume a soft accessory is harmless over an airbag area. Follow the vehicle owner’s manual and keep both the pillow and strap completely clear of the seam.
Adjusting while driving
Do not reach behind the seat or move the pillow while the vehicle is in motion. Park safely before making any change.
Treating the pillow as medical equipment
This type of product is an interior comfort accessory. It is not designed to treat pain, correct posture, prevent injury or replace a factory head restraint.
Cleaning without damaging the surface
Follow the care label supplied with the pillow. For routine surface cleaning, use a soft damp cloth, blot rather than scrub, and allow the pillow to air dry completely before reinstalling it.
Do not machine wash, apply heat or use cleaning chemicals unless the product label specifically allows it.

That feedback is useful, but seat geometry still matters. A good result in one vehicle does not guarantee identical placement in another.
A better installation is a reversible installation
The best setup is easy to reposition or remove. If the pillow changes visibility, pedal reach, steering control, seat-belt fit or access to a safety feature, remove it and return the seat to its normal configuration.
